Vassallo Achieves CISM

GraVoc's Dan Vassallo offically became the company's third Certified Information Security Manager in the eyes of the Information Systems Audit and Control Association (ISACA) last week. This designation recognizes an individual's experience and understanding of "the relationship between an information security program and broader business goals and objectives," according to the ISACA website. Vassallo joins roughly 13,000 individuals with the CISM, including GraVoc's David Gravel and Nate Gravel, but joins a smaller group of CISMs who have also displayed the ability to blog about themselves in the third person.

GraVoc Staff Earns Certifications

In response to the business environment becoming more competitive, several GraVoc Associates professionals have demonstrated their competence in GraVoc’s three practices of information systems, information technology, and technology and professional services.  Several staff members have earned certifications over the course of the summer, and the organization is using this space to congratulate them:

  • Nate Gravel has achieved the CISM (Certified Information Security Manager) certification from the Information Systems Audit and Control Association (ISACA).  There are only about 10,000 CISMs worldwide, and Nate, 24, is likely one of the youngest to earn this certification.  A CISM demonstrates experience in the fields of information security governance, information risk management, information security program development and management, and incident response.  Nate also earned a Microsoft Certified Professional (MCP) certification in the Microsoft Dynamics CRM software.
  • Eric Hannabury has added his seventh MCP distinction, as he successfully earned certification in the installation and configuration of Microsoft Dynamics GP 10.0.  Eric already holds the Microsoft Certified Systems Engineer (MCSE) certification, one of the premiere validations of technical capabilities in designing and implementing Microsoft network infrastructure.
  • Ron Smoller, also an MCSE, has earned his sixth MCP distinction in the installation and deployment of Microsoft Dynamics CRM 4.0.
  • Doug Tilley earned an MCP in the field of Microsoft Dynamics GP 10.0 Financials.
  • Matt Wilkins earned an MCP in the area of the customization and configuration of Microsoft Dynamics CRM 4.0.
